Hooghly, West Bengal, 07 Jan.2026 | : Dr. Sujeet Kumar Shaw is a distinguished educator under the Government of West Bengal, whose life and work exemplify discipline, resilience, and service to society. With over 17 years of continuous teaching experience, he has earned national and international recognition for his contributions to education, social upliftment, and environmental advocacy.

Born on 11 October 1976 in Telinipara, Bhadreshwar, Hooghly, to Late Binda Shaw and Late Faguni Devi, Dr. Shaw overcame severe physical challenges from early childhood—including loss of vision in his right eye and absence of the right hand—transforming adversity into lifelong motivation and leadership

Despite financial hardship, he pursued education with determination, often studying under streetlights, and chose teaching as a mission of public service.

Academically, he holds B.A. (History Honours), M.A. in History (First Class), and B.Ed. (First Class). He served 12 years at Jamuria Hindi High School (H.S.), Asansol (2009–2021) and, since March 2021, has been serving as Assistant Teacher (History) at Gondalpara Sastri Hindi High School (H.S.), Chandannagar. Known for structured, concept-driven pedagogy, he integrates life skills, discipline, patriotism, and self-reliance into learning.

Beyond classrooms, Dr. Shaw’s impact is wide-ranging. He provides free weekend coaching to underprivileged students, mentors over 150 disadvantaged learners annually, and has developed tactile learning tools for visually impaired students. He is also the founder of the environmental campaign “Let’s Make Our Earth Green”, mobilising hundreds of students, leading large-scale Hooghly River clean-up drives, and advocating tree-plantation initiatives recognised by national bodies.

His service has been acknowledged through numerous honours, including the National Teachers Award (2024), Swarn Bharat Samman,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am National Award, Rabindranath Tagore Humanitarian Excellence Award, and Global Icon Award. He has received 17 National and 3 International Honorary Doctorates, reflecting sustained contribution rather than isolated achievement.
